Roofing inspection services involve a thorough evaluation of a property's roof to identify existing issues and potential vulnerabilities. These inspections typically include examining the roof’s surface, flashing, gutters, and drainage systems to detect signs of damage, wear, or deterioration. The goal is to assess the overall condition of the roof, determine if repairs are needed, and evaluate its ability to protect the property from weather elements. Inspections can be scheduled regularly or performed after severe weather events to ensure the roof remains in good condition and to prevent small problems from developing into costly repairs.
By conducting a detailed roof inspection, property owners can address problems such as leaks, missing or damaged shingles, and compromised flashing before they cause significant damage. Early detection of issues like water intrusion, mold growth, or structural stress can help prevent more extensive and expensive repairs down the line. Inspections also provide valuable information for planning maintenance or replacement projects, ensuring that repairs are targeted and effective. This proactive approach can extend the lifespan of the roof and safeguard the property’s interior and structural integrity.

Inspection Cost Range - The typical cost for a roofing inspection varies between $150 and $400, depending on the size and complexity of the roof. Larger or more complex roofs may cost more, sometimes exceeding $500.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ific property details.
Pricing Factors - Costs are influenced by factors such as roof height, accessibility, and the extent of inspection required. For example, a standard residential roof might cost around $200, while a commercial roof could be $500 or more. Service providers can offer tailored quotes based on property specifics.
Additional Charges - Additional fees may apply for detailed reports or extensive inspections, often ranging from $50 to $150 extra. These costs depend on the scope of the inspection and any necessary follow-up assessments by local service providers.
Cost Variability - Prices for roofing inspections can vary widely across different regions and providers. In Rockland County, NY, typical inspections usually fall within the $150 to $400 range, but prices may differ based on local market conditions and property characteristics.

What is a roofing inspection service? A roofing inspection service involves assessing the condition of a roof to identify potential issues, damage, or areas needing maintenance, typically performed by local roofing professionals.
How often should a roof be inspected? It is generally recommended to have a roof inspected at least once a year and after severe weather events to ensure its integrity and address any damage promptly.
What are common signs that a roof needs an inspection? Visible damage such as missing shingles, leaks, sagging areas, or granule loss on shingles can indicate the need for a professional roof inspection.
What does a roofing inspection typically include? The inspection usually covers checking for damage, wear, and tear, assessing flashing and gutters, and evaluating overall roof stability.
How can a roofing inspection benefit property owners? Regular inspections can help detect issues early, potentially preventing costly repairs and prolonging the roof's lifespan through timely maintenance.
